What is personal information?

Personal information is information that relates to a living individual, and allows that individual to be identified.

Certain types of personal information is categorised as ‘sensitive personal data’, this is information which relates to racial or ethnic origin, political opinions, religious beliefs, membership of a trade union, physical or mental health, sexual life, alleged or real offences and proceeds from offences.

A ‘cookie’ is information that a website stores on your computer so that it can remember something about you at a later time. Cookies are commonly used on the internet and do not harm your system.


Watmos.org.uk never stores any information in cookies (on any computer that you may use) that others could read and understand about you, such as your name or address.
 

If you do not want to accept cookies on any website, you may be able to change your browser settings to not accept them. Please refer to your browser’s ‘help’ facility for further information.
